Andrew Hill’s administration obstacle

Ask staff whether or not they wish they ended up doing one thing else and they say indeed much more typically when they are at do the job than when they are stress-free. That is a paradox, in accordance to Mihaly Csikszentmihalyi, the Hungarian-American psychologist, for the reason that staff are much more possible to report currently being in an pleasurable “flow” point out when they are at do the job, than when at leisure.

Csikszentmihalyi, who died lately, was “the father of flow”, the experience of currently being pleasurably lost in an engaging activity. His paradox lives on and resolving it is in part the career of supervisors, as I’ve penned this 7 days. So for my administration obstacle, I’d like to know how you would really encourage staff associates again into circulation — is the resolution in staff choice, technological assistance or some other managerial technique? Last 7 days I requested for your suggestions for earning hybrid conferences do the job greater. Dan Kiernan presented these: “Log in two to three devices in the place to give diverse digital camera angles and capture all people. Even a telephone propped up on a beanbag operates. Coach 1 of the cameras on the display the distant participants are currently being revealed on, it provides them self-confidence they are currently being observed. Make guaranteed the chat is currently being observed, so distant participants can soar in that way.” He provides — and I wholeheartedly endorse this — “The essential, as with all conferences, is a superior chairperson.”
